Mold Abatement Service in Frisco, TX
Mold abatement services focus on identifying and removing mold growth from residential properties to improve indoor air quality and protect the health of occupants. These services typically cover projects involving visible mold on walls, ceilings, or other surfaces, as well as areas affected by water damage or high humidity. Property owners often seek mold abatement when noticing musty odors, discoloration, or respiratory issues, and they want to understand the scope of removal, the affected areas, and the steps involved in restoring a safe living environment.
Before requesting mold abatement, homeowners usually want clarity on the extent of mold contamination, whether the problem is localized or widespread, and the procedures used to eliminate mold effectively. It’s also common to inquire about the potential need for repairs or moisture control measures to prevent future growth. Understanding these aspects helps property owners make informed decisions about addressing mold issues and maintaining a healthy home environment.

Common Mold Abatement Service Jobs
Mold Remediation - comprehensive removal of mold from affected areas to improve indoor air quality.
Attic Mold Removal - addressing mold growth in attic spaces caused by moisture and poor ventilation.
Bathroom Mold Cleanup - eliminating mold in bathrooms where humidity promotes growth.
Basement Mold Treatment - treating mold issues in basements due to dampness and water intrusion.
HVAC Mold Cleaning - removing mold from air ducts and vents to prevent spread throughout the property.
Water Damage Mold Prevention - preventing mold development after water leaks or flooding incidents.
Mold Abatement Service Questions
What is mold abatement? Mold abatement involves removing mold growth from indoor environments to improve air quality and prevent health issues.
When is mold abatement needed? It is recommended when mold is visible or suspected due to water damage, leaks, or high humidity levels.
What areas can mold abatement services address? Services typically target areas like basements, bathrooms, attics, and HVAC systems where mold growth commonly occurs.
How does mold abatement improve property safety? Removing mold reduces airborne spores and prevents structural damage, supporting a healthier living or working space.
